Zstandard Compressed
Source formatZstandard (Zstd) is a fast lossless compression algorithm developed by Yann Collet at Facebook. It provides compression ratios comparable to zlib while being 3-5x faster at both compression and decompression, making it ideal for real-time data processing.
LZMA Compressed
Target formatLZMA (Lempel-Ziv-Markov chain Algorithm) is a high-ratio compression algorithm developed by Igor Pavlov for the 7-Zip archiver. It achieves significantly better compression than gzip or bzip2, especially on text and binary data, at the cost of higher memory usage.

ZST vs LZMA — Strengths and limitations
What each format does best, and where it falls short.
ZST Strengths
- Extremely fast decompression (~2 GB/s on modern CPU).
- Scalable: very fast at level 1, near-xz ratios at level 22.
- Dictionary support for small-payload efficiency.
- Multi-threaded by default.
- Standardized (RFC 8478), BSD-licensed reference.
Limitations
- Newer than gzip/bzip2 — some legacy tools still lack support.
- At extreme compression levels, xz can still win on ratio.
- Memory usage at high levels is significant.
LZMA Strengths
- Highest-ratio mainstream compression (beats gzip by 30%).
- Public domain SDK — royalty-free.
- Mature since 1998 with no breaking changes.
- Core of 7z, xz, .tar.xz workflows.
- Multi-threaded LZMA2 scales across CPU cores.
Limitations
- Slow compression at highest settings.
- Memory-hungry — 1 GB+ for extreme compression levels.
- Zstandard matches its ratios at less memory cost.
ZST vs LZMA — Technical specifications
Side-by-side comparison of the technical details.
ZST
- MIME type
- application/zstd
- Extension
- .zst
- Algorithm
- LZ77 variant + entropy coding (FSE/Huffman)
- Standard
- RFC 8478 (2018)
- Compression levels
- 1-22 (plus negative "fast" levels)
LZMA
- MIME type
- application/x-lzma
- Algorithm
- Lempel-Ziv-Markov chain + range coding
- Extensions
- .lzma, .lz
- Public domain SDK
- Yes (since 2001)
- Variants
- LZMA (original), LZMA2 (multi-threaded, used in xz)

ZST vs LZMA — Typical file sizes
Approximate file sizes for common scenarios.
ZST
- Default level 3 on source code 28-35% of original
- Level 22 ultra on source code 14-18% of original
- Linux kernel (.tar.zst, level 19) ~130 MB
LZMA
- Text/source archive 15-25% of original
- Linux kernel source (.tar.xz = LZMA2) ~125 MB
- Windows system backup (.lzma) 25-40% of original
